Output 5033898756910ec920297b69da91fdc93239ecea2ef1a10e37517950e2b680ea:0

value
174534663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ca86d387a7d1ba9582b515ba81cc7a73ac6eb0d OP_EQUAL
address
3A8wrgRMQuq2rp23RzT52vgWCJw897KdVU
transaction
5033898756910ec920297b69da91fdc93239ecea2ef1a10e37517950e2b680ea
spent
true